OLIGOSACCHARIDE-BINDING TO FAMILY 11 XYLANASES: BOTH COVALENT INTERMEDIATE AND MUTANT-PRODUCT COMPLEXES DISPLAY 2,5B CONFORMATIONS AT THE ACTIVE-CENTRE
Template:ABSTRACT PUBMED 11526340
About this Structure
1H4H is a 4 chains structure of sequences from Bacillus agaradhaerens. Full crystallographic information is available from OCA.
Reference
- Sabini E, Wilson KS, Danielsen S, Schulein M, Davies GJ. Oligosaccharide binding to family 11 xylanases: both covalent intermediate and mutant product complexes display (2,5)B conformations at the active centre. Acta Crystallogr D Biol Crystallogr. 2001 Sep;57(Pt 9):1344-7. Epub 2001, Aug 23. PMID:11526340
